Established in 1987, Frontlines exists to offer services to the people and groups of the Weston community, one of Toronto’s 13 Priority Neighbourhoods. They have focused their efforts on high-risk children and youth from the beginning, and believe in a community approach to making Weston a safer and better place. Thanks to many individual donors and granting organizations, they are able to offer a variety of programs for the children and youth of Weston.
Through club initiatives, special events and drop-in times, the Frontlines staff of trained workers and volunteers provide a friendly environment
where people feel both cared for and safe. It is a place where children and youth are encouraged to choose constructive alternatives that will further growth and development. Beyond working with the physical, mental and social needs of youth, Frontlines also strives to address their spiritual needs.
Frontlines programs provide practical, tangible services that meet real needs and add value to groups within the community. Through programming, staff build impactful relationships with participants and their families. These relationships foster collaborative problem solving and create positive change.
